Located in the bohemian Rio Vermelho neighborhood of Salvador, Canto de Yansã is more than just a tourist attraction; it's a vibrant cultural landmark dedicated to Yansã, the Afro-Brazilian goddess of winds and storms. The energetic ambiance welcomes visitors with the sounds of live music, laughter, and the enticing aromas of traditional Bahian cuisine. Visitors are captivated by the colorful decorations and intricate artwork that adorn the space, reflecting the deep-rooted spiritual significance of Yansã in local traditions. Canto de Yansã offers an array of activities that allow you to immerse yourself in the local culture. Engage with knowledgeable locals who are eager to share their stories and traditions, or participate in vibrant dance performances that showcase the rhythms of Afro-Brazilian heritage. The venue also hosts regular events, from capoeira demonstrations to drum circles, offering an opportunity for tourists to witness and even join in the celebrations. Food lovers will be delighted by the culinary offerings. Sample classic Bahian dishes such as acarajé, moqueca, and farofa, each bursting with flavors that reflect the local ingredients and culinary traditions. The surrounding area is equally enchanting, with charming streets lined with shops selling handmade crafts, clothing, and artworks that highlight the region's artistic flair.
